Determining the Right Brightness and Color Temperature for Your Space

Selecting the right brightness and color temperature for your LED light strip is essential. Brightness is measured in lumens. Too bright can feel harsh. Too dim may not provide enough light. Understand what you need the light for. Ambient lighting requires less brightness than task lighting. Aim for around 300-500 lumens for general use.

Color temperature is another critical factor. It’s measured in Kelvin (K). Warmer lights (around 2700K) create a cozy atmosphere. Cooler lights (above 5000K) are more energizing. The right choice depends on your space. A living room might benefit from warmer tones. In contrast, a kitchen could use cooler hues for clarity.

Exploring Power Supply Requirements for Optimal Performance

When selecting LED light strips, understanding power supply requirements is crucial. The power supply should match the voltage of the LED strip. Most strips operate on either 12V or 24V. Using the wrong voltage can damage the lights. Remember, a higher voltage doesn’t mean brighter lights; it means you might be risking your installation.

Consider the wattage of your light strip. Check the specifications for how much power it consumes per meter. This helps in choosing the right power adapter. A power supply with insufficient wattage can lead to flickering lights or, worse, complete failure. It’s tempting to go for a cheaper adapter, but that's often a false economy. Be wary of underpowered supplies; they can create frustration.

Power connectors also matter. Ensure your connectors are compatible with your strips. Poor connections lead to overheating and short circuits. Not every power supply fits every strip. Compatibility can sometimes be overlooked. It's easy to assume everything will work seamlessly together, but a few extra checks can save you from future headaches.

Maintaining and Troubleshooting Your LED Light Strips

Maintaining and troubleshooting LED light strips can feel daunting, yet it’s essential for maximizing their lifespan. A report by the LED Lighting Institute suggests that the average lifespan of LED strips is about 50,000 hours, but improper handling can significantly reduce this. Regularly check your 4ft Led Strip Light for signs of wear or damage. Look for flickering or uneven brightness, which can indicate a loose connection or a need for replacement.

Cleaning is often overlooked. Dust and grime can accumulate, affecting performance. A soft cloth lightly dampened with water can help maintain brightness. However, excessive moisture can cause damage, so be cautious. Remember, it’s not just about cleaning but also about placement. Installing strips in high-heat areas may lead to premature failure. It’s important to reflect on your placement before making a decision.

Troubleshooting involves basic electrical understanding. If your strips don’t illuminate, check the power source first. A blown fuse or faulty adapter could be the culprit. Additionally, ensure that power ratings align with your LED specifications. Adjustments may be necessary if you find mismatch issues. Always be prepared to revisit your setup.
